Dean Sandoval

I enjoyed an early supper here with my Mom. There are PLENTY of non sushi options for her, along with delicious, creative sushi selections. I also enjoyed some non sushi items because they sounded so good and hey were delicious!
There is a Happy Hour menu with plenty of smaller to shareable plates to choose from as well!

Vegetarian options: There isn’t a specific section, yet it’s easy to read which menu items are vegetarian.

Dietary restrictions: The menu is very informative about ingredients & the staff is accommodating.

Parking: Good sized parking lot with accessible parking right up front.

Kid-friendliness: I don’t have kids, but there were a couple of families with children when we were there.

Wheelchair accessibility: Restaurant has wheelchair accessible entry and tables.
